Security, fairness and provable indicators

Here are practical checks to evaluate whether Chicken Road (or any slot) is safe to play:

  • Licence: Play on sites regulated by provincial authorities or well-known international bodies with a good track record.
  • RNG and testing: Look for third-party audit mentions (e.g., eCOGRA, iTech Labs) and visible RNG certification.
  • RTP transparency: The game should display an RTP figure in its information screen or casino help pages.
  • Responsible gaming tools: Deposit limits, self-exclusion and clear T&Cs are signs of reputable operators.

Comparison with popular slots

Below is a quick comparison table placing Chicken Road first, followed by several popular slots that Canadian players often encounter. Data such as RTP and volatility are typical reported ranges; always confirm these with your chosen casino.

Slot Provider Reported RTP Volatility Notes
Chicken Road Independent studio (various partners) ~95–97% Medium to High Fun theme, free spins and multipliers; good for casual play
Starburst NetEnt ~96.1% Low Simple gameplay, strong mobile performance
Book of Dead Play’n GO ~96.21% High High volatility, popular among risk-takers
Mega Moolah Microgaming ~88–92% (progressive) High Progressive jackpot, low base RTP due to jackpot pool
Gonzo’s Quest NetEnt ~95.97% Medium Avalanche mechanic and solid bonus features
